Which of the following locations served as the headquarters for General Washington’s troops during the winter of 1777-1778?

It was primarily "Valley Forge, Pennsylvania" that served as the headquarters for General Washington’s troops during the winter of 1777-1778, which was an incredibly brutal winter in which many people died of exposure.

What adverse effect emerged from African Americans migrating North in search of jobs during World War I?
umka2103 [35]

The correct answer is B) Race riots in several cities.

<em>The adverse effect emerged from African Americans migrating North in search for jobs during World War 1 was race riots in several cities. </em>

Black men from the Southern states emigrated to the Northern stats during World War 1. They were looking for better job and living opportunities in the North, where the fabrics of munitions and weaponry were hiring many women. This process was called The Great Migration. African Americans populated larger cities of the North like New York, Chicago, Detroit, and St. Louis. They began to form black communities in those areas. But the adverse effect emerged from African Americans migrating North in search for jobs during World War 1 was race riots in several cities.
